FAN CONTROL KNOB
This knob turns thefan ONand OFF, andcontrols fanspeed.
MODE CONTROL KNOB
This knob controls theoutlet airflow.
TEMPERATURE CONTROLKNOB
This knob allows adjustment ofthe temperature ofthe outlet air.
RECIRCULATION (REC)SWITCH
OFF position:
Outside airisdrawn intothepassenger compartment.
ON position:
Interior airisrecirculated insidethevehicle.
The indicator lampwillalso light.

TROUBLEDIAGNOSES
Operational Check
The purpose ofthe operational checkisto confirm thatthesys-
tem operates asitshould. Thesystems whicharechecked are
the blower, mode(discharge air),intake air,temperature
decrease, temperature increase.
CONDITIONS:
Engine running atnormal operating temperature.

TROUBLEDIAGNOSES
Performance Chart
TEST CONDITION
Testing mustbeperformed asfollows:
Vehicle location: Indoorsorinthe shade (inawell-venti-
lated place)
Doors: Closed
Door window: Open
Hood: Open
TEMP.: Max.COLD
Discharge Air:Face Vent
REC switch: (Recirculation) set
FAN speed: Highspeed
Engine speed:Idlespeed
Operate theairconditioning systemfor10minutes before
taking measurements.
